Ein E-Übersetzer in Rust

BearbeiterIn:Sebastian Hahn
Titel:Ein E-Übersetzer in Rust
Typ:
Betreuer:Krainz, J.; Werth, T.; Philippsen, M.
Status:abgeschlossen am 14. Dezember 2016
Vorausetzungen:
Thema:

Rust ist eine moderne Sprache die als Allzwecksprache mit Fokus auf Systemprogrammierung entworfen wurde. Wesentliche Eigenschaften von Rust sind u.A. die Unterstützung von Parallelisierung, sowie die Einhaltung von Speichersicherheit bei gleichzeitigem Verzicht auf automatische Speicherbereinigung.

Im Rahmen dieser Projektarbeit wurde die Tauglichkeit von Rust bei der Implementierung eines mittelgroßen Software-Projekts evaluiert. Hierbei wurde u.A. evaluiert, wie sich das Speicherverwaltungsverhalten von Rust auf Programmentwurf und -implementierung auswirken.

watermark seal